The Cecil County Race Meet is spearheaded by the NEGN Club, aka: Northeast Chapter of the GSCA, headed by John and Nancy Csordas who do a superb job, they are straight shooters, top notch no BS! The Cecil County race event is top notch and long running with great cash payouts and now has recently included a car show as in recent years the event has been growing! Not to mention you will no doubt run your fastest times ever at Cecil County, that you can take to the bank! It's the home to many of the fastest Buicks around.
